## Formula sandbox tuning

User-supplied formulas in Gridmoor execute inside a restricted interpreter with hard ceilings on time, memory, and call depth. Reviewers should confirm any change to these ceilings is justified in the PR description, since raising them widens the abuse surface. Defaults were chosen from production traces. The current limits are as follows.

limits module of tafog-fawip:
WEIGHTS = {
    "julix": 57,
    "lamys": 992,
    "kasvan": 209,
    "quenok": 750,
    "alddor": 259,
    "oliath": 1009,
    "wenix": 815,
}

To: Executive Team
Subject: Harwick Tooling — acquisition status

Diligence on Harwick Tooling is 80% complete. Valuation range holds at 5.1–5.6x EBITDA. Two flags: pension liability and an expiring lease at their Drayfen site. Finance to stress-test synergies by Friday. No outside disclosure until signing. Decision needed at Thursday's session. Background on our intentions is set out below.

internal memo for faduf-fajop: Headcount on the Fraox team goes from 28 to 114 by the end of September. Gross margin on Fraox came in at 49 percent against a plan of 60 percent.

# Break-Glass: Catalog Cache Invalidation

Scope: the Pinrow product catalog at Veldstone Retail. If stale prices persist after a purge and the Hollowmere invalidation queue is wedged, use break-glass to flush the edge tier directly. Contractors: get verbal sign-off from the catalog lead first. Steps: open the Hollowmere admin shell, select emergency-flush, confirm the tenant, and run it once — repeated flushes thrash the origin. Access is logged and expires after 20 minutes. Unseal the admin shell with the passphrase below.

recovery phrase for kahop-tajog: istix-casvan

Handover — Ilya to Renn (night shift)

Locker reshuffle in the changing rooms finished today. Night-shift lockers are now 40–58, back wall only; day staff keep the front bank. Old tags have been removed, so assign new starters from the laminated sheet in the desk drawer and note the number in the log. Lockers release via the wall keypad by the mirrors. The current keypad code is below.

staff pass of kawip-hawef = bdg-QLP-2